Section 1: Unlocking Business Growth with Data-Driven Insights

The CISR is particularly valuable in the business world, where data analysis is key to informed decision-making. By applying statistical techniques, businesses can identify trends, optimize operations, and predict future outcomes. A notable example is the case of Walmart, which utilized data analysis to improve its supply chain management. By analyzing sales data and weather patterns, Walmart was able to anticipate demand and adjust its inventory accordingly, resulting in significant cost savings and improved customer satisfaction. Similarly, companies like Amazon and Google use statistical analysis to personalize customer experiences, driving engagement and loyalty.

Section 2: Informing Public Policy with Statistical Evidence

The CISR is also essential in the public sector, where data-driven decision-making is critical to policy development and evaluation. Statistical analysis can help policymakers identify areas of need, measure program effectiveness, and allocate resources efficiently. For instance, the city of New York used data analysis to inform its crime reduction strategy, identifying high-crime areas and deploying targeted interventions. As a result, crime rates decreased significantly, and community safety improved. Similarly, the World Health Organization (WHO) relies on statistical analysis to track disease outbreaks and develop targeted interventions, saving countless lives worldwide.

Section 3: Enhancing Research and Development with Statistical Techniques

In the realm of research and development, the CISR is a valuable asset for scientists, academics, and innovators. Statistical analysis can help researchers identify patterns, test hypotheses, and validate findings. A notable example is the Human Genome Project, which used statistical techniques to analyze vast amounts of genetic data and identify patterns associated with various diseases. Similarly, researchers in the field of climate science rely on statistical analysis to model climate patterns, predict future changes, and inform policy decisions.
